Output add0ed31acbed5378b90317a2f59cf64e685f9e7e3e2c5c68d4e8cabc0a60f72:0

value
809859584
script pubkey
OP_0 OP_PUSHBYTES_20 8dbad84f2e707f7e9a2d71ec8186526847e3acaa
address
bc1q3kadsnewwplhax3dw8kgrpjjdpr78t92rn82q9
transaction
add0ed31acbed5378b90317a2f59cf64e685f9e7e3e2c5c68d4e8cabc0a60f72
spent
true